Comparative Advantage vs Absolute Advantage in Blockchain

In blockchain ecosystems, comparative advantage allows projects to specialize and coexist efficiently, especially within DeFi protocols. Absolute advantage, however, belongs to networks or algorithms that outperform others in speed, cost or execution. Platforms with superior code and infrastructure gain decisive edges in fast-moving markets. The interaction between these two advantages forms the backbone of quantitative trading systems.

Measuring Trading Efficiency Through Quantitative Techniques

Modern crypto markets rely on quantitative frameworks such as machine learning, time-series analysis and backtesting to evaluate performance. These techniques enhance algorithmic trading efficiency, improve risk management and allow simulation of diverse market conditions—an essential capability in volatile environments.

Sustainability of Advantage in DeFi and Layer-1 Systems

Sustainable dominance in DeFi and Layer-1 systems depends not only on technology but also on regulation, transparency and user trust. Platforms that integrate advanced algorithms gain liquidity and execution advantages, yet new entrants can disrupt incumbents as conditions shift. Competitive advantage remains dynamic and requires constant adaptation.
